ORDINANCE NO. ~ 3 ~ ~ ° ~ <br />ORDINANCE AMENDING CHAPTER 2, ARTICLE 17 OF THE <br />SOUTH BEND MUNICIPAL CODE PROVIDING FOR A <br />DEPOSIT PRIOR TO ADVERTISING FOR SALE OF PROPERTY <br />STATEMENT OF PURPOSE AND INTENT <br />From time to time the City will determine that certain real property with an assessed <br />value of less than $5,000 should be sold under IC 36-1-11-5 to an interested adjacent property <br />owner or other buyer. The usual procedure in such circumstances is that an interested party will <br />inquire as to the availability of the property, and the City will then advertise to sell the property <br />awarded to the highest bidder. Occasionally no bid is ever received, even from the person who <br />originally inquired. In those circumstances, the City of South Bend loses the cost of the <br />advertisement, plus labor and other associated costs. To help offset such costs, it is proposed that <br />a deposit be required of the person requesting that the property be advertised for sale. <br />N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T ORDAINED BY THE SOUTH BEND COMMON <br />COUNCIL as follows: <br />Section 1. Article 17 of Chapter 2 of the South Bend Municipal Code entitled "Charges <br />for Reports and Services" shall be amended by adding §2-206 to read as follows: <br />Section 2-206. Deposit Required Prior to Advertisement for Sale of Land <br />(a) A $100.00 per parcel deposit shall be required of any party (except for other <br />governmental entities and not-for-profit corporations qualified under 501(c) of the <br />Internal Revenue Code) who requests that the City sell a particular parcel of land <br />prior to advertisement. <br />(b) The deposit shall be collected by the Department of Public Works at <br />the time of the request and shall be applied as follows: <br />1. If the City determines for whatever reason that it cannot <br />or should not sell the property, the entire deposit shall be returned to <br />the requesting party. <br />2. If the property is put up for sale and no bid is received, <br />the deposit shall become the property of the City. <br />3. If the property is sold to someone other than the <br />requesting party, the deposit shall be returned to the requesting <br />party. <br />
